Finalists announced for the Thames Valley Tech Awards

Published by
TBM Team

The third annual Thames Valley Tech Awards takes place during an extremely challenging period that has seen the region’s tech sector respond very strongly. Winners from the line-up of finalists in 10 categories will be celebrated at a special online awards event on September 24.

Television presenter Vernon Kay will host the interactive virtual awards from a studio in Reading. There will be opportunities for networking before the one-hour awards ceremony and audience participation during it. A Tweet Wall will run live throughout.

Impressive line-up of finalists

Commenting on the quality of this year’s finalists, Peter Laurie, head of client relations for The Business Magazine, said: “What came through most clearly to the judges from their meetings with the contenders is just how buoyant the Thames Valley tech sector is despite the uncertainty caused by Covid-19.

“The judges were impressed by all the entries, so choosing the finalists and winners was as difficult as ever. We were delighted, in particular, to receive a high number of first-time entrants.”

Sponsors

The awards are organised by The Business Magazine to recognise the outstanding achievements of The Thames Valley’s tech companies. Headline sponsors are Westcoast and Marsh Commercial. The other sponsors are Barclays, BDO, Blake Morgan, Crowe, EY, Hays, Incloud Solutions, LDC and Verlingue. The media partner is Jargon PR.
